CSIR UGC NET 2024 Application Form, Exam Date, Eligibility, Pattern, Syllabus

CSIR UGC National Eligibility Test (NET) is conducted by National Testing Agency on behalf of the Council of Scientific and Industrial Research. After clearing the examination the candidates will be eligible for the post of Assistant Professor and Junior Research fellowship. CSIR UGC NET Examination Pattern

The mode of examination is MCQ-based. It is a 200 marks examination with a total of 3 hours allotted to complete the examination. The examination pattern of the CSIR NET is different for different subjects. The following are the examination pattern of CSIR NET-

CSIR NET Exam Pattern for Chemical Sciences

CSIR NET Chemical Science Paper PartsNumber of Questions in CSIR NET Chemical Science PaperCSIR NET Chemical Science Paper Marks
A20 (Questions to be attempted: 15)30
B40 (Questions to be attempted: 35)70
C60 (Questions to be attempted: 25)100
Total120 (Questions to be attempted: 75)200

Marking Scheme

CSIR NET Chemical Science Paper PartsMarks Allotted for Each Question Marks Deducted for Each Question
A+2-0.5
B+2-0.5
C+4-1

CSIR NET Exam Pattern for Earth, Atmospheric, Ocean, and Planetary Sciences

CSIR NET Earth Science Paper PartsNumber of Questions in CSIR NET Earth Science PaperCSIR NET Earth Science Paper Marks
A20 (Questions to be attempted: 15)30
B50 (Questions to be attempted: 35)70
C80 (Questions to be attempted: 25)100
Total150 (Questions to be attempted: 75)200

Marking scheme

CSIR NET Earth Science Paper PartsMarks Allotted for Each Question Marks Deducted for Each Question
A+2-0.5
B+2-0.5
C+4-1.32

CSIR NET Exam Pattern for Life Sciences

CSIR NET Life Science Paper PartsNumber of Questions in CSIR NET Life Science PaperCSIR NET Life Science Paper Marks
A20 (Questions to be attempted: 15)30
B50 (Questions to be attempted: 35)70
C75 (Questions to be attempted: 25)100
Total145 (Questions to be attempted: 75)200

Marking scheme

CSIR NET Life Science Paper PartsMarks Allotted for Each Question Marks Deducted for Each Question
A+2-0.5
B+2-0.5
C+4-1

CSIR NET Exam Pattern for Mathematical Sciences

CSIR NET Mathematical Science Paper PartsNumber of Questions in CSIR NET Mathematical Science PaperCSIR NET Mathematical Science Paper Marks
A20 (Questions to be attempted: 15)30
B40 (Questions to be attempted: 25)75
C60 (Questions to be attempted: 20)95
Total120 (Questions to be attempted: 60)200

Marking scheme

CSIR NET Mathematical Science Paper PartsMarks Allotted for Each Question Marks Deducted for Each Question
A+2-0.5
B+3-0.75
C+4.750

CSIR NET Exam Pattern for Physical Sciences

CSIR NET Physical Science Paper PartsNumber of Questions in CSIR NET Physical Science PaperCSIR NET Physical Science Paper Marks
A20 (Questions to be attempted: 15)30
B25 (Questions to be attempted: 20)70
C30 (Questions to be attempted: 20)100
Total75 (Questions to be attempted: 55)200

Marking scheme

CSIR NET Physical Science Paper PartsMarks Allotted for Each Question Marks Deducted for Each Question
A+2-0.5
B+3.5-0.875
C+5-1.25
